Naval History - Of the 5 others I read this is the best,
By
This review is from: Naval History Magazine (Magazine)
Naval History is the single best history magazine I read. One small thing that makes this outstanding is that often those who made the history comment in the letters to the editor. This contains the work of the best history writers today and often spans the ages in its articles. What is really special is that several times a year they commit an entire issue to one historic event. They include fold out maps and articles from various authors. Naval History is highly recommended.
